The Colorado Affidavit of Defendant Spouse in Support of Motion to Amend or Strike Alimony Provisions of Divorce Decree Because of Cohabitation By Dependent Spouse is a legal document commonly used in divorce cases within the state of Colorado. This affidavit is filed by the defendant spouse (the spouse who is paying alimony) to request the court to modify or eliminate the alimony obligations outlined in the divorce decree due to the cohabitation of the dependent spouse (the spouse receiving alimony). Colorado Spousal Maintenance Calculation Colorado courts take 40 percent of the divorcing couple's combined monthly adjusted gross income (AGI) and subtract from that the lower-earning spouse's monthly AGI.

There are three major criteria that can qualify you for an alimony modification: Sudden increase/decrease in income. Change in child-rearing expenses. Sudden loss of assets or property.

Factors that go into alimony determination include each spouse's income and financial resources, the future earning capacities of the spouses, the length of the marriage, age and physical and emotional conditions of the spouses, and whether the spouse seeking alimony payments will obtain child support or property from ...

You will generally not be required to pay maintenance for more than half the time you were married. Once you've been married for 12 and a half years, the maintenance term becomes 50 percent of the length of the marriage. If you were married for 20 years, you could receive alimony for 10 years.

Unless an ex-spouse remarries or dies, the supporting party can only terminate payments through a court order.

Bottom Line. In order to avoid paying spousal maintenance, you must show the court that your former spouse does not need it. Spousal maintenance is not mandatory in Colorado. In fact, you may not have to pay it if you can show the court that your spouse can support themselves following the divorce.

First, take both parties monthly, adjusted gross income and add it together to get their combined, monthly adjusted gross income. Multiply that number by 40%. Subtract the lessor-earning spouse's monthly adjusted gross income. If the number is zero or less, there is no maintenance payable.
